摘要:
Using spectroscopic data for the edge-on spiral NGC 5775, discussed in a paper by Rand in these proceedings, we attempt to address the issue of how Diffuse Ionized Gas (DIG) halos are energized. Data are interpreted in the context of composite photo-ionization/shock models. We find that an increasing contribution from shocks with z is necessary to explain observed line ratios. In addition, the runs of [O-III]/Halpha vs. z in NGC 5775 suggest that shocks make a greater contribution in regions where DIG is of a filamentary morphology.
